About The Position

The Cyber Security Project Engineer manages security assessment, security compliance, change management, and continuous monitoring responsibilities across four (4) cloud service providers: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ud, Oracle Cloud, and Microsoft Azure. This position requires a healthy mix of technical and policy knowledge and requires support in understanding and implementing standards like NIST Risk Management Framework and cloud technologies. The position also requires proficiency in information system security engineering and security control assessment.

Responsibilities

  • Demonstrated experience conducting security assessments, particularly for cloud infrastructure and cloud services.
  • Demonstrated experience facilitating TEMs with cloud service providers to review cloud service architectures
  • Demonstrated experience designing, implementing, assessing or reviewing systems that utilize cloud technology with either Amazon Web Services, Oracle Cloud, Google Cloud, or Microsoft Azure cloud architecture.
  • Demonstrated experience utilizing or reviewing cross domain technology and common architecture designs.
  • Demonstrated experience with continuous monitoring requirements to include scan analysis for critical or high findings with common scan tools such as Rapid 7, Nessus, and Qualys.
  • Demonstrated experience monitoring or closing Plan of Action and Milestone items (POA&Ms).
  • Demonstrated experience utilizing compliance tools to track assessment and authorization activities such as Xacta 360, Risk Vision, RSA Archer.
  • Demonstrated experience with the common control provider concept within the NIST Risk Management Framework.
  • Demonstrated experience with security control assessments to include working with SCAs and preparing security packages for SCAs.
  • Demonstrated experience conducting information system security engineering activities.
  • Demonstrated project management experience including project planning, task tracking, milestone management, and resource coordination
  • Demonstrated experience developing and maintaining program metrics, performance indicators, and compliance status dashboards
  • Demonstrated experience preparing technical reports, program highlights, status briefings, and leadership communications
